    ^ yeah, I 2nd this. HE60, HE90, and Milos' clones are much closer to "neutral" for me, and I think by now ultra knows what my "neutral" is really like. :)

    I think HD650 is a bit too far south... too dark and a bit dulled, despite me really liking how it handles upper mid/lower treble transition compared to HD580/600. It seems there really is no happy medium here.

    Something like HE1, on the other hand, is just a bit too far north. Sibilance galore. I would have preferred it to be a bit smoother, even if it would end up sounding splashy, but it was no doubt still the most impressive "headphone sound" I've ever.
